The Infrastructure Boom: Lambda's $500M Bet on KC
The most significant development in the Kansas City technology sector for 2025 is the arrival of Lambda, a provider of computation for artificial intelligence. In a move that signals a massive shift in the region's technological gravity, Lambda has announced plans to transform an unoccupied facility in Kansas City, Missouri, into a state-of-the-art 'AI Factory.' This investment, valued at over $500 million, is not merely a real estate transaction; it represents the installation of the physical backbone required for the next generation of computing. With plans to deploy more than 10,000 NVIDIA GPUs, this facility will position Kansas City as a critical node in the national AI infrastructure grid.
Scheduled to launch in early 2026, this deployment is part of a broader trend of 'emerging hyperscalers' seeking locations that offer the right balance of energy availability, central logistics, and talent. For local businesses, the presence of gigawatt-scale AI factories changes the narrative of the Midwest. No longer just a consumer of coastal technology, Kansas City is becoming a producer of the compute power that drives global innovation. Mayor Quinton Lucas and the Economic Development Corporation of Kansas City have framed this as a pivotal moment, capitalizing on the region's ability to support the heavy industrial requirements of modern AI training and inference.
Current Adoption Rates: The 'Nascent' Opportunity
While the infrastructure is rapidly advancing, current adoption rates among Kansas City businesses suggest a market ripe for transformation. According to the 'KC Tech Specs v.08' report released by the KC Tech Council, Kansas City currently ranks No. 53 among U.S. metro areas in AI adoption as of mid-2025. The Brookings Institution characterizes the city as a 'nascent adopter.' While some might view this ranking as a lag, savvy entrepreneurs and investors see it as a massive arbitrage opportunity. The gap between infrastructure potential and current implementation creates a vacuum that local MSPs (Managed Service Providers) and tech consultants are poised to fill.
The KC Tech Specs report highlights a critical strategic pivot for early- to mid-stage tech companies in the region. Faced with an evolving capital landscape, local startups are being urged to use AI not just for novelty, but for survival. The report notes that companies are leveraging artificial intelligence to 'extend their runway' by eliminating redundancies and enhancing internal efficiency. This pragmatic approach to AI—focusing on cost-cutting and operational analytics rather than speculative hype—is becoming the hallmark of the Midwest tech ecosystem. As capital becomes more expensive, the ability to automate internal insights is separating surviving startups from those that fold.

Ecosystem Upgrades: AI for Entrepreneurs
The integration of AI isn't limited to massive data centers; it is trickling down to the support systems that nurture local small businesses. KCSourceLink, the region's primary hub for connecting entrepreneurs with resources, recently secured a $250,000 regional node grant from the Missouri Technology Corporation (MTC). This funding is explicitly earmarked for a technology upgrade that includes artificial intelligence integration.
Currently, navigating the web of grants, mentors, and incubators can be daunting for a new founder. The AI upgrades at KCSourceLink aim to streamline this by using predictive algorithms to match entrepreneurs with the specific resources they need, faster than human navigators could alone. This 'smart matching' capability ensures that the diverse resources available in Kansas City are more accessible to a wider range of founders, potentially accelerating the speed at which new businesses can launch and scale. It is a prime example of how AI is being applied to civic technology to reduce friction in the local economy.
Workforce Shifts: Disruption and New Horizons
The narrative of AI in Kansas City is inevitably tied to workforce disruption. Reports from the Missouri Business Alert highlight a dual reality: while traditional roles in sectors like financial services may face decline due to automation, new opportunities are springing up in hardware and data management. Clyde McQueen, CEO of the Full Employment Council of Kansas City, has emphasized that the region is transitioning from general administrative employment to specialized technical roles.
The Full Employment Council recently completed a staffing search for a Northland data center, signaling the beginning of a hiring wave related to the physical maintenance of the AI internet. Furthermore, local startups like Uwazi.ai are demonstrating that Kansas City can be a home for AI-native software companies. Uwazi.ai focuses on using AI to promote civic engagement, proving that the Midwest can innovate in the application layer of AI, not just the infrastructure layer. The challenge for local business leaders will be reskilling a workforce defined by 'nascent' adoption to meet the demands of a hyperscaler hub.
Q: How does Kansas City's 'Nascent Adopter' status impact local businesses?
A: Being classified as a 'nascent adopter' (Rank #53) implies that while AI usage isn't yet ubiquitous, the market is unsaturated. For B2B technology companies, this presents a significant opportunity to help traditional KC industries (logistics, agriculture, finance) bridge the gap. It also suggests that local talent costs may be lower than in saturated hubs like San Francisco, allowing for more capital-efficient growth.
